  jessicafischerqueen: <benji> I never once got any better at actually playing chess from reading a book. I've only ever improved my playing strength by playing people at a long time control (at least 90 minutes each) around 50 points higher than me and then analyzing the game (blunder checking, really) after with my computer.

That's hard work, however, it can be excruciating.

Luckily, however, I haven't done such work for a good three years now, and I've dropped back three levels probably.

Less pressure here at the bottom.

P.S. Studying chess with books is a talent all it's own. Most recreational chess players just can't grasp all the concepts and the frustating endless variations on the what if lines of many chess books. Other than getting a sound idea on what you are trying to accomplish with a given opening studying chess is for the very devoted and imo gifted players. For most laymen chess players I think practising tactics & playing 20 to 30 minute games online also with 5 & 10 minute blitz games against similar competition is the best way to improve.
